Output d628c61c30c7ba2a934704f4a50bc0dcd71f0062acdfa1fe596ebbc05a73ca8a:0

value
399929
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f35fa0ed9cfbe0a7e337f942a56b00ab7d8b8ea7 OP_EQUALVERIFY OP_CHECKSIG
address
1PBqm1UYmF5xyodqmwhFMGJ7qoE2JeWfXH
transaction
d628c61c30c7ba2a934704f4a50bc0dcd71f0062acdfa1fe596ebbc05a73ca8a
confirmations
306554
spent
true